Unmanned Delivery Vehicles are automated transportation systems designed to deliver goods without human operators. These vehicles come in various forms, from drones zipping overhead to ground-based robots moving along sidewalks. As urban populations swell, the demand for quick and efficient delivery methods skyrockets. According to a 2022 report from Statista, the global drone delivery market is projected to reach $11 billion by 2026, showcasing the increasing reliance on technology for everyday needs.

Now, it’s crucial to address safety—undoubtedly the top concern for anyone contemplating the use of UDVs. Modern UDVs are equipped with an array of advanced sensors and cameras that enable them to detect obstacles and navigate busy urban environments. For instance, some drones can fly at elevated altitudes, avoiding pedestrian traffic, while ground vehicles utilize cameras to monitor the surroundings in real-time.
Still, concerns about accidents and malfunctions persist. A 2021 study from the Journal of Urban Technology found that while UDVs reduced in-transit damages by 30%, the failures in navigation technology led to a 5% rise in crashes. Educating the public about their design features, and ensuring stringent safety standards, could mitigate these fears.

What’s next for Unmanned Delivery Vehicles? Predictive analytics and artificial intelligence (AI) are two game-changing technologies making waves in this field. Picture this: UDVs can analyze traffic patterns using AI, allowing them to choose the fastest routes in real time. Such innovations not only enhance delivery speed but also ensure sustainability, reducing emissions from traditional delivery vehicles.
Moreover, a report by the World Economic Forum highlights how the integration of 5G technology can further empower UDVs, enabling instant communication between vehicles and urban infrastructures. This cohesive network minimizes delays and enhances safety protocols, paving the way for smart cities of the future.
